Stepmania should come with a handy little program that can do it for you. It's called Stepmania Tools and Package Exporter or something. Open the Program folder; it ought to be in there. Open it. The last option is "Create Song". Choose that, find the song file, and after the success message, load StepMania, go to Edit/Sync songs, create a blank by choosing the type and difficulty and press Enter.

And now, you step.
